Transaction 42245d98c409862216a4946ee13f82a2635903bde5fd2ed11737100c0e03329f

1 Input
2 Outputs
  • 42245d98c409862216a4946ee13f82a2635903bde5fd2ed11737100c0e03329f:0
  • value  626770
    address  17CfXYKUz4oRQstrsrF3qVw3NCfi6g9NYi
  • 42245d98c409862216a4946ee13f82a2635903bde5fd2ed11737100c0e03329f:1
  • value  844946373
    address  3MXFMrpjBCrQ3ohGxnNaEFtEA9gyXrTHCW